Witryna23 paź 2024 · There are two types of immunological tolerance: natural and acquired. 1. Natural tolerance. Natural tolerance is the absence of a response to self-antigens. It develops throughout embryonic development, and every antigen that contacts the immune system during embryonic development is regarded as self-antigen. Witryna17 kwi 2024 · Affinity vs avidity. Affinity and avidity are both measures of binding strength. While affinity is the measure of the binding strength at a single binding site, avidity is a measure of the total binding strength. Antibodies have between two and ten binding sites.
